Coimbatore Corporation Organizes Special Bank Loan Camp for Street Vendors

Coimbatore Corporation is conducting a special camp from August 24 to 29 at its head office and five zonal offices to provide Rs.15,000 bank loans to street vendors. Commissioner Katta Ravi Teja urged vendors to bring Aadhaar card and bank passbook to avail the facility.


Coimbatore: Coimbatore Corporation Commissioner Katta Ravi Teja announced that a special camp will be organized on August 24, 25, 27, 28, and 29 to provide bank loans to street vendors operating within the Corporation limits. The camp will be held at the Corporation head office and five zonal offices.

The special camp has been arranged to enable street vendors within the Corporation area to obtain loans of Rs.15,000 through banks. The camp will be conducted on Monday, August 24, Tuesday, August 25, Thursday, August 27, Friday, August 28, and Saturday, August 29, from 10 AM to 5 PM.

Street vendors interested in availing bank loans must participate in this camp. The Commissioner stated that vendors must bring essential documents including their Aadhaar card and bank passbook.

This scheme is expected to enhance the livelihood of street vendors. Since the camp will be held at the Corporation head office and five zonal offices, vendors can visit the most convenient location to benefit from this facility.
